MacPherson Hunting Ancient Tartan Kilt
The MacPherson Clan is a Scottish Highland clan, based in the Highlands of Scotland, in the shire of Inverness. The name of the clan has its origins in the ancient Celts who lived in the Highlands and their name translates to Son of the Parson in Gaelic which is associated with the early Scottish church and leadership positions. The MacPhersons belonged to the great confederation of the Clan Chattan, who was also full of bravery and loyal. They were able to build a rich history of survival and a proud heritage over generations in Scottish history.
Color Scheme and Pattern
MacPherson Hunting tartan is a blend of black, grey, red, and blue, and each color is representative of different values of the clans heritage. Black is a symbol of strength, grey is a symbol of wisdom and stability, red is a symbol of courage, and blue is a symbol of loyalty and honor.
